【问题标题】:Incorporating django-tables2 into Django-CMS将 django-tables2 合并到 Django-CMS
【发布时间】:2013-10-23 03:37:15
【问题描述】:

如何在 django-cms 模板中使用 django-tables2 输出?由于 django-cms 使用插件作为页面元素,我应该为它编写一个自定义插件来处理我使用 django-tables 2 生成的表吗?我还有其他元素,例如 django-filter 表单,它们也可以合并到 Django-cms 中吗?

【问题讨论】:

    标签: django django-cms django-tables2


    【解决方案1】:

    创建一个使用 django-tables2 模型的 django CMS 插件 [1]。

    [1]http://docs.django-cms.org/en/2.4.2/extending_cms/custom_plugins.html

    【讨论】:

    • 感谢@ojii,但我在弄清楚如何将其编写为自定义插件时遇到了问题。这是我第一次这样做。目前我正在使用调用 Django-tables2 的 CBV 方法,我不确定该方法是否可以在自定义插件中使用。你会怎么做呢?我有一个列表视图和一个详细视图页面,它们都需要表格插件。我设法为插件的模型和 table_class 启动了一个表单,但我不确定如何将它修补到 Django-tables2 代码。感谢您的意见!
    猜你喜欢
    • 2016-01-16
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多